Output 3ad5920671ba19034f10a48611b0875a32e8b5d7f1e5d96226629bb3f5bc4f1f:0

value
1370262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 911889702744dbd57fdf159962d8147125a7db58 OP_EQUAL
address
3EvDJDAkYv6ibs5VeRwMX4PurW8LCfQooN
transaction
3ad5920671ba19034f10a48611b0875a32e8b5d7f1e5d96226629bb3f5bc4f1f
confirmations
104187
spent
true